Struct cpio::newc::Builder
[−]
[src]
pub struct Builder { /* fields omitted */ }
Builds metadata for one entry to be written into an archive.
Methods
impl Builder
[src]
pub fn new(name: &str) -> Builder
[src]
pub fn ino(self, ino: u32) -> Builder
[src]
pub fn mode(self, mode: u32) -> Builder
[src]
pub fn uid(self, uid: u32) -> Builder
[src]
pub fn gid(self, gid: u32) -> Builder
[src]
pub fn nlink(self, nlink: u32) -> Builder
[src]
pub fn mtime(self, mtime: u32) -> Builder
[src]
pub fn dev_major(self, dev_major: u32) -> Builder
[src]
pub fn dev_minor(self, dev_minor: u32) -> Builder
[src]
pub fn rdev_major(self, rdev_major: u32) -> Builder
[src]
pub fn rdev_minor(self, rdev_minor: u32) -> Builder
[src]
ⓘImportant traits for Writer<W>pub fn write<W: Write>(self, w: W, file_size: u32) -> Writer<W>
[src]
ⓘImportant traits for Writer<W>